Symbolism of Cockroaches in Dreams
Cockroaches in dreams symbolize various themes, often reflecting your emotions and circumstances. Understanding these symbols can provide insight into your subconscious mind and current life situations.
Common Interpretations
- Fear and Anxiety: Cockroaches often represent feelings of fear or anxiety. Encountering these insects in a dream might indicate that you’re grappling with stressors or unresolved issues in your waking life.
- Invasion of Personal Space: If cockroaches invade your dreams, it may signal feelings of being overwhelmed or invaded in your personal life. This could relate to intrusive thoughts, unwelcome situations, or toxic relationships.
- Resilience: Cockroaches symbolize survival and resilience. Dreaming of them might suggest that you have the inner strength to overcome challenges or adversity, reflecting your ability to adapt and thrive.
- Neglect or Dirt: Dreams featuring cockroaches can point to neglected aspects of your life, such as personal relationships or responsibilities. This might encourage you to address and clean up areas where you’ve let things slide.
- Reflection of Inner Turmoil: From a psychological standpoint, cockroaches in dreams can embody your inner fears and insecurities. Analyzing these dreams can help confront issues like self-doubt or feelings of inadequacy.
- Symbol of Autonomy: Cockroaches thrive even in harsh environments. Dreaming of them might signify a desire for independence or self-reliance, highlighting your quest for autonomy despite external challenges.
- Processing Trauma: If you’ve experienced a traumatic event, dreaming about cockroaches might signify the need to process those feelings. This dream could serve as a prompt to confront past experiences for healing.
By recognizing these symbols and interpretations, you can better understand what your dreams about cockroaches might reveal about your thoughts and feelings.
Cultural Significance of Cockroaches
Cockroaches hold various meanings across cultures, often symbolizing resilience and adaptability.
Folklore and Myths
In many cultures, cockroaches appear in folklore and myths. For instance, in some African traditions, they represent survival in harsh conditions. Cockroaches can symbolize tenacity, as they have existed for over 300 million years. In contrast, Asian cultures sometimes view cockroaches as creatures associated with bad luck or disease. These varying perceptions highlight the complexity of cockroaches in cultural narratives.
Regional Variations
Regional interpretations of cockroaches can differ significantly. In Latin America, cockroaches are often seen as reminders of neglect or decay in one’s life. Meanwhile, in urban settings, they reflect the challenges of living in crowded environments. In contrast, Indigenous cultures may regard cockroaches as symbols of nature’s resilience. Understanding these regional nuances provides insight into how cockroaches are perceived globally and the emotions linked to them.
